Understanding the Cash Home Selling Process


What Does Selling for Cash Mean?


When you sell your home for cash, it means that the buyer is able to pay the full purchase price without needing to secure financing through a mortgage. This can significantly speed up the closing process, as there are fewer hurdles to overcome. Cash buyers can include real estate investors, companies that specialize in buying homes, or individuals with sufficient funds.


Benefits of Selling Your Home for Cash


  1. Speed: Cash transactions can close in as little as a week, compared to traditional sales that may take months.

  2. Less Stress: Without the need for appraisals and inspections, the process is often smoother.

  3. No Repairs Needed: Many cash buyers are willing to purchase homes "as-is," meaning you won't have to invest time or money into repairs.

  4. Certainty: Cash offers are generally more reliable, reducing the risk of the sale falling through due to financing issues.


Preparing Your Home for Sale


Declutter and Clean


Before listing your home, it’s essential to declutter and clean every room. A tidy space allows potential buyers to envision themselves living there. Here are some tips:


  • Remove Personal Items: Take down family photos and personal memorabilia.

  • Organize Closets: Buyers often look at storage spaces, so make them look spacious and organized.

  • Deep Clean: Consider hiring a professional cleaning service to ensure your home sparkles.


Make Minor Repairs


While cash buyers may not require extensive repairs, addressing minor issues can make your home more appealing. Focus on:


  • Fixing Leaky Faucets: Small repairs can make a big difference in buyer perception.

  • Touching Up Paint: A fresh coat of paint can brighten up your home.

  • Ensuring All Lights Work: Replace burnt-out bulbs to create a welcoming atmosphere.


Setting the Right Price


Research the Market


To sell your home quickly, it’s crucial to set a competitive price. Research similar homes in your area to understand the market. Consider:


  • Online Real Estate Platforms: Websites like Zillow or Realtor.com can provide insights into local listings.

  • Consulting a Real Estate Agent: An experienced agent can offer valuable advice on pricing strategies.


Be Open to Negotiation


While you want to get the best price possible, being flexible can help you close the deal faster. Consider:


  • Setting a Slightly Lower Price: This can attract more buyers and lead to multiple offers.

  • Offering Incentives: Consider covering closing costs or including appliances to sweeten the deal.

Working with Cash Buyers


Finding Cash Buyers


There are several ways to find cash buyers for your home:


  • Real Estate Investors: Many investors are looking for properties to flip or rent.

  • Cash Home Buying Companies: These companies specialize in purchasing homes quickly for cash.

  • Networking: Let friends, family, and colleagues know you’re selling; they may know someone interested.


Evaluating Offers


When you receive offers, evaluate them carefully. Consider:


  • The Offer Amount: Is it fair based on your research?

  • Closing Timeline: How quickly can the buyer close?

  • Contingencies: Are there any conditions that could delay the sale?


Closing the Sale


Understanding the Closing Process


Once you accept an offer, you’ll enter the closing process. This typically involves:


  1. Signing a Purchase Agreement: This legally binds you and the buyer to the sale.

  2. Title Search: Ensures there are no liens or issues with the property title.

  3. Closing Day: You’ll sign the final paperwork and receive your cash payment.


Preparing for Closing


To ensure a smooth closing process, gather necessary documents such as:


  • Property Deed: Proof of ownership.

  • Tax Records: Information on property taxes.

  • Homeowners Association Documents: If applicable.
